How To Get Six Pack Abs

Wednesday, January 27th, 2010

If you work out, learning how to get six pack abs is likely high on your list of priorities. You’ll not only look better if you build six-pack abs, you’ll gain more confidence as well. It takes some effort and willpower to get abdominal definition, but if you stick with the right dieting and exercising program, you will succeed.
If you want to know how to get six pack abs you need to combine diet and exercise to get rid of any extra body fat around your waist. This extra body fat is what keeps most people from getting abs. The key to losing this unwanted fat is to increase your metabolism, or metabolic rate, which is the rate at which the body burns calories for energy.

As far as diet goes, eating 5 or 6 small meals daily is one of the best ways to get six pack abs. The process of eating actually speeds up your metabolism so you burn more body fat. Going on a starvation diet will lower your metabolism and make fat harder for you to burn fat. However, when you eat more frequently you need to make sure that your meals are low in calories. Your meals also need to be nutritious and high in protein. This doesn’t mean that you have to go on an extremely low-carb or low-fat diet. These macronutrients are important for many bodily functions. Just make sure to consume most of your carbs during your earlier meals because they’ll be less likely to end up being stored as fat. You should also have as many natural foods in your diet as possible if you want to get defined abs.

Of course you need to exercise if you want to get six-pack abs. What most people don’t realize is that it doesn’t take hour after hour of exercise every day to burn fat and get into shape. What it takes is high intensity training when you work out.

While cardiovascular exercise will help you burn a lot of calories, you can take it a step further and boost your metabolism by performing your cardio workouts with more intensity. Whether you run, bike, or exercise on an elliptical machine you should do some bursts of high intensity training to get the most out of it. This will allow you to finish your cardiovascular workouts in less time with all of the fat burning benefits. You may have heard that it’s best to do between 45 minutes and an hour of cardiovascular training every day to burn fat and get 6 pack abs, but this isn’t necessarily true. Look at elite sprinters as compared to elite distance runners – the sprinters always look more defined. If you work hard, a cardiovascular workout shouldn’t take longer than 20 to 30 minutes.

Weight training is another form of exercise you must do when you want to know how to get six pack abs. Building more muscle mass will boost your resting metabolic rate so that you are burning extra calories all of the time. The core of your body, which includes the abs, will also get work from stabilizing the body when you are lifting heavy weights. If you weight train with high intensity you should be able to get a great workout finished in 45 minutes or less. When you weight train, it’s best to focus most of your workout on performing the tough, compound exercises such as squats, deadlifts, power cleans, bench presses, pull-ups, rows, and military presses.

If you switch between doing cardiovascular and weight training workouts every other day, you’ll find that it won’t take as much time as you thought to get 6 pack abs. You can also opt to do both one day and rest the next. Whatever the case, you won’t need to spend your life in the gym to get into great shape if you train hard enough.

The Truth About Getting Six Pack Abs is More Then Stomach Flattening Exercises

Wednesday, January 27th, 2010

The first thing that you think you need to do to get a set of six pack abs is a whole slew of stomach flattening exercises. Sit-ups, crunches, and leg raises are first on the list and if you are like most people you start doing these exercises with hopes of getting those washboard abs. But as you and many others have found out working just your abdominal muscles does little in the quest for a flat and firm stomach.

The reasons that getting a set of six pack abs is not as simple as it sounds is nothing more then the physiological way in which the human body works. If you don’t alter the way you approach attaining your goal you will never reach it. With this in mind you have to approach flattening your stomach through two methods of attack: Diet and Exercise.

Here’s why what you eat and how you exercise have such a large impact on whether you can see your abs or not. You see the thing is your abs are already there but if you are like most people there is a nice layer of belly fat hiding them. And until you get rid of that layer of fat your six pack will not show at all.

The first truth about six pack abs is changing your diet. Eating right is a critical component of any fat burning regimen. The best foods to choose are those that are nutrient dense, high in fiber, and high in complex carbohydrates. F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ean cuts of meat eaten in five to six smaller meals throughout the day is the best way to go.

The second truth about six pack abs is you need a complete body exercise program that includes stomach flattening exercises. By exercising the right way you kick your metabolism up another level and increase the rate at which your body burns away body fat. Concentrate on your major muscle groups because as you build these they tap into that stored fat energy.

In addition to building muscle it is important to mix in some cardio or aerobic exercise as well. This not only burns calories but is good for your overall cardiovascular health.

These two truths about six pack abs will serve you much better in your quest for a healthy body. Remember, there is more to getting firm and flat abdominals then just stomach flattening exercises.
